New Healthy Spirits in the Inner Richmond [San Francisco]
Was happy to see that Healthy Spirits had a healthy expansion, taking on a new location on Clement near 11th. The new spot is larger than the Divis/15th location, which had led to nice upgrades: much larger assortment of liquors, liqueurs and bitters; about 1/3 more refrigerator space, with a more expansive selection of ciders--I've already tried and disliked Crispin and Tieton (both too sweet) and am curious about West County and the three Normandie brands they carry. I was excited to see the entire Mikkeller yeast line-up 2.0 (they made 6 beers from the same malt, hops & recipe, but used a different yeast in each one). Good homework in advance of the Mikkeller bar opening.
Same selection of Middle Eastern dips & spreads made by the owners mom (I like the red pepper/eggplant one), ice creams and a few packaged goods.

Hm, not sure then. The subscription series is a "mystery box" in a way, but a little more expensive (about $50 per month). You get a mixed box of booze, sometimes with a theme, and always with exceptionally well written PDF tasting notes from the beer manager. It's one of my favorite gifts to give beer lovers in SF.
